Distributors package the skins separately. It’s basically boxing up all the skins from the boneless skinless chicken breast you buy in the store. I got it for something ridiculous like $0.49/# and use it so it doesn’t go to waste.

Of course! We tried it two ways, but the most effective was this

-Dry your chicken skins

-Hold them in a brine of buttermilk, hot sauce, egg mix (purely for ease of use on line, I’d only leave them 15-20 minutes if you’re doing it at the house)

-Toss them in a flour dredge

-Once coated deep fry, you could probably get away with a pan fry with shallow oil but I was blessed with a deep fryer.

Drying the skins and then frying without the wet/dry mix did not yield the crisp you would want (just a warning).
